What are the common signs of plumbing leaks that lead to water damage?

Common signs of plumbing leaks include unexpected water bills, the sound of running water when fixtures are turned off, damp spots on walls or ceilings, stained or peeling paint, and mold growth. You may also notice a musty smell or discover water pooling in your basement or around fixtures. If you notice any of these symptoms, it’s crucial to act quickly to mitigate water damage and avoid costly repairs.

How can I prevent water damage from plumbing leaks?

To prevent water damage from plumbing leaks, regularly inspect your plumbing system for signs of wear or corrosion. Make sure to monitor water pressure, as excessive pressure can lead to leaks. Know where your main shut-off valve is located in case of emergencies. Keeping your gutters clean and maintaining proper drainage around your property can also help prevent leaks. If you suspect a leak, call a professional plumber immediately to repair it before significant damage occurs.

What should I do if my home suffers from water damage due to a plumbing leak?

If your home suffers water damage from a plumbing leak, first ensure that the source of the leak is stopped. You can turn off the water supply to the affected area if possible. Next, assess the damage and contact a water damage restoration professional. They will help remove any standing water, dry out your home, and begin the repair process. Take pictures of the damage for insurance purposes and keep the affected area well-ventilated to prevent mold growth.

Does homeowners insurance cover water damage from plumbing leaks?

Homeowners insurance often covers water damage from sudden and accidental plumbing leaks; however, coverage can vary based on the circumstances and your specific policy. It’s essential to review your policy or talk to your insurance agent to understand what is covered. For instance, damage resulting from poor maintenance or gradual leaks may not be covered. Always report any leaks to your insurance provider as soon as possible.
